Global trade regulations significantly impact the leather industry. This article will explore how businesses can adapt to these regulations and ensure compliance.
Familiarizing oneself with international trade agreements is crucial. These agreements dictate tariffs and duties, affecting the cost of leather exports.
Each country has specific laws governing leather exports. Businesses must understand these laws to avoid legal complications.
Proper documentation and certifications are essential for smooth exports. Suppliers should ensure they have all necessary paperwork in place.
Regulations can change frequently. Establishing a system to monitor these changes helps businesses stay compliant and avoid penalties.
Partnering with trade compliance experts can simplify navigating regulations. These professionals provide valuable insights and assistance.
Adapting to global trade regulations is vital for success in the leather export market. By staying informed and compliant, businesses can thrive in a competitive environment.
